High School Student Obligation Information
Report cards have been held in the past for student obligations such as books, uniforms, cafeteria fees, or any other fees that may occur during the time your child has been enrolled at
Kingsway High School.
We will no longer hold report cards due to present and/or past student obligations that have accrued.
All students will no longer be able to attend Field Trips including the Senior Trip, Attend Club Activities – including dances
(Homecoming/ Prom), or join Sports unless obligations are paid.
Juniors that have not paid by the end of this school year will be ineligible to receive a Parking Permit for next school year.
Seniors will not receive diplomas at the end of the year until obligations are paid.
Students that owe an obligation receive a letter in homeroom periodically during the school year.
Obligation payments can be made in the High School Main Office, Monday – Friday from 8:00AM – 3:00PM.
If paying with cash, please have exact change.
If paying by check, please call (856) 467-3300 to find out how payment should be applied.
If a student has a large obligation that has accrued, please contact us and we can work out a payment plan.
We like to encourage all students to pay before the end of the school year.
